Mariah Hay is the CEO and co-founder of Allboarder, a company transforming employee onboarding through automation. Formerly CXO at Help Scout and VP of Product at Pluralsight, she has built innovative products, led high-performing teams, and guided Pluralsight through a successful IPO. A passionate advocate for financial literacy, Mariah became financially independent in 2022 and now inspires others through her Instagram (@FieryMariah). She holds an MFA in Industrial Design from SCAD and a BA in Studio Art from the College of Charleston.
